See the GNU *  Lesser General Public License for more details. * *  You should have received a copy of the GNU Lesser General Public *  License along with this library; if not, write to the Free Software *  Foundation, Inc., 59 Temple Place, Suite 330, Boston, MA  02111-1307  USA * *  Contact: *  Laboratoire de Vision et Systemes Numeriques *  Departement de genie electrique et de genie informatique *  Universite Laval, Quebec, Canada, G1K 7P4 *  http://vision.gel.ulaval.ca * *//*! *  \file   beagle/GP/PrimitiveSet.hpp *  \brief  Definition of the type GP::PrimitiveSet. *  \author Christian Gagne *  \author Marc Parizeau *  $Revision: 1.14 $ *  $Date: 2005/09/30 15:04:53 $ */#ifndef Beagle_GP_PrimitiveSet_hpp#define Beagle_GP_PrimitiveSet_hpp#include <string>#include "beagle/config.hpp"#include "beagle/macros.hpp"#include "beagle/Object.hpp"#include "beagle/Allocator.hpp"#include "beagle/Pointer.hpp"#include "beagle/Container.hpp"#include "beagle/System.hpp"#include "beagle/RouletteT.hpp"#include "beagle/GP/Primitive.hpp"#include "beagle/GP/PrimitiveMap.hpp"#ifdef BEAGLE_HAVE_RTTI#include <typeinfo>#endif // BEAGLE_HAVE_RTTInamespace Beagle {namespace GP {// Forward declarationclass System;/*! *  \class PrimitiveSet beagle/GP/PrimitiveSet.hpp "beagle/GP/PrimitiveSet.hpp" *  \brief The GP primitive set class. *  \ingroup GPF *  \ingroup Primit *  \ingroup GPSys */class PrimitiveSet : public Primitive::Bag {public:  //! GP::PrimitiveSet allocator type.  typedef AllocatorT<PrimitiveSet,Primitive::Bag::Alloc>          Alloc;  //! GP::PrimitiveSet handle type.  typedef PointerT<PrimitiveSet,Primitive::Bag::Handle>          Handle;  //! GP::PrimitiveSet mixed bag type.  typedef ContainerT<PrimitiveSet,Primitive::Bag::Bag>          Bag;#ifdef BEAGLE_HAVE_RTTI  explicit PrimitiveSet(const std::type_info* inRootType=NULL);#else  // BEAGLE_HAVE_RTTI           PrimitiveSet() { }#endif // BEAGLE_HAVE_RTTI  virtual ~PrimitiveSet() { }#ifdef BEAGLE_HAVE_RTTI  virtual const std::type_info* getRootType() const;#endif // BEAGLE_HAVE_RTTI  virtual void              initialize(GP::System& ioSystem);  virtual void              insert(Primitive::Handle inPrimitive, double inBias=1.0);  virtual Primitive::Handle select(unsigned int inNumberArguments, GP::Context& ioContext);#ifdef BEAGLE_HAVE_RTTI  virtual Primitive::Handle selectWithType(unsigned int inNumberArguments,                                           const std::type_info* inDesiredType,                                           GP::Context& ioContext);#endif // BEAGLE_HAVE_RTTI  virtual void              readWithContext(PACC::XML::ConstIterator inIter, GP::Context& ioContext);  virtual void              write(PACC::XML::Streamer& ioStreamer, bool inIndent=true) const;  /*!   *  \brief Get the primitive of the name given.   *  \param inName Name of the primitive to get.   *  \return Handle to the named primitive, a NULL handle if there is no primitive of the given name.   */  inline GP::Primitive::Handle getPrimitiveByName(string inName) const  {    Beagle_StackTraceBeginM();    GP::PrimitiveMap::const_iterator lMapIter = mNames.find(inName);    if(lMapIter == mNames.end()) return GP::Primitive::Handle(NULL);    GP::Primitive::Handle lPrimitive = castHandleT<GP::Primitive>(lMapIter->second);    return lPrimitive;    Beagle_StackTraceEndM("GP::Primitive::Handle GP::PrimitiveSet::getPrimitiveByName(string inName) const");  }#ifdef BEAGLE_HAVE_RTTI  /*!   *  \brief Set the associated tree's root type.   *  \param inRootType Root type.   */  inline void setRootType(const std::type_info* inRootType)  {    Beagle_StackTraceBeginM();    mRootType = inRootType;    Beagle_StackTraceEndM("void GP::PrimitiveSet::setRootType(const std::type_info* inRootType)");  }#endif // BEAGLE_HAVE_RTTIprotected:  typedef std::pair<bool,RouletteT<unsigned int> > RoulettePair;  typedef std::map< unsigned int,RoulettePair,std::less<unsigned int>,                    BEAGLE_STLALLOCATOR< std::pair<const unsigned int,RoulettePair> > >          RouletteMap;  std::vector< double,BEAGLE_STLALLOCATOR<double> > mSelectionBiases;  //!< Selection biases.  GP::PrimitiveMap                                  mNames;            //!< Look-up table (by name).  RouletteMap                                       mRoulettes;        //!< Nb. args -> roulette map.#ifdef BEAGLE_HAVE_RTTI  const std::type_info* mRootType;         //!< Associated root type. Used only with STGP.#endif // BEAGLE_HAVE_RTTI};}}#endif // Beagle_GP_PrimitiveSet_hpp
